On November 20, 1971, President Richard M. Nixon and Charles W. Colson met in the Oval Office of the White House at an unknown time between 8:09 am and 8:37 am. The Oval Office taping system captured this recording, which is known as Conversation 621-012 of the White House Tapes.
Nixon Library Finding Aid:
Conversation No. 621-12 Date: November 20, 1971 Time: Unknown between 8:09 am and 8:37 am Location: Oval Office The President dictated a memorandum to Charles W. Colson. James D. Hodgson's possible speech to American Federation of Labor-Congress of Industrial Organizations [AFL-CIO] -President’s previous speech at AFL-CIO convention -George Meany -Treatment of the President -The President's role in preparation -Content and phraseology -The President's relations with labor and labor leaders
